My son attended the True North Sports Camps basketball program in Toronto this summer and had a solid experience overall. He’s an active kid, and he absolutely loved the chance to improve his dribbling and shooting skills with the guidance of Coach Sam, who was very encouraging. Each day, they worked on different drills, and my son was excited to show off his new moves at home. The pickup process was smooth, and I appreciated the clear communication from the staff throughout the week. However, there were a couple of days when we faced long lines during drop-off, which was a bit frustrating. Despite that, my son made some great friends and returned home every day with a big smile. I would recommend this camp, especially for kids who enjoy being outdoors and engaged in sports, but keep an eye on the drop-off process.

My son attended the True North Sports Camps basketball program in Toronto last week, and overall, it was a solid experience. The skills he learned, like dribbling and shooting, were practical and engaging. The instructors, like Coach Ben, were attentive and really kept the kids motivated throughout the full-day sessions. I also appreciated the outdoor time, which allowed the kids to enjoy the fresh air. Pickup was smooth, which is always a plus. However, we did encounter some long lines during drop-off on the first day, which was a bit chaotic and stressful. My son is quite active, so he thrived in the energetic environment, and he even made a new friend. If you're considering this program, just be prepared for the early morning rush. I would recommend it for kids looking to improve their basketball skills while having fun.
